Hammer crusher is mainly used to crush material by impact. The crushing process is roughly like this. The material enters the crusher and is broken by the impact of a high-speed rotary hammer. The broken material obtains kinetic energy from the hammerhead, and thus rushes towards the baffles and screen bars at high speeds.

6.5 Impact Crushers. Impact crushers (e.g., hammer mills and impact mills) employ sharp blows applied at high speed to free-falling rocks where comminution is by impact rather than compression. The moving parts are "beaters," which transfer some of their kinetic energy to the ore particles upon contact. Internal stresses created in the particles are often large enough to …
